About Maniac Mansion

Maniac MansionNorth American box art.Developer(s)Lucasfilm GamesPublisher(s)JalecoRelease Date(s)Nintendo Entertainment SystemNA:September1990EU:October 22,1992Platform(s)Genre(s)Point-and-click adventureGalleryโ€ขCheatsโ€ขVideosManiac Mansionis a point and click game, developed byLucasfilm Games. TheNESversion is a1988port of a 1987 home computer game. It was later made into a television series, although little from the game survived into the TV show's plot.
